  9. A lot of people can see the break of a putt correctly, but try to roll the ball along that line.

    An easy trick is to place an imaginary cup on the highest spot of the break that u see (66% approx of the way as Matty says), see the break to that spot, then putt to that imaginary cup. Especially useful for gauging correct pace on longer big breaking putts on fast greens.
